The mean real estate brokers salary in Tennessee is $62,910, about 25.1% below the U.S. average ($83,950). That works out to roughly $30/hr at 2,080 hours per year.

Metro Areas in Tennessee

Metro areaMedianMeanEmployment
Nashville-Davidson--Murfreesboro--Franklin, TN $62,350 $68,270 170
Knoxville, TN $58,280 $57,900 70
Memphis, TN-MS-AR $52,570 $61,480 80
Kingsport-Bristol, TN-VA $45,250 $60,560 40
